Early Life Andy Williams was born as Howard Andrew Williams on December 3, 1927 in Wall Lake, Iowa to Florence and Jay. He had three older brothers named Don, Bob, and Dick. The family later moved to Cheviot, Ohio, a suburb of Cincinnati. As a teen, Williams went to Western Hills High School in Cincinnati before finishing his high school education at University High School in Los Angeles, California, where he had moved with his family.

Chloe Sevigny had always liked doing theater, but had never viewed acting as a way to make a living. She quite literally stumbled into a modeling career when she was spotted on the street by an editor for Sassy Magazine. She began modeling for the magazine, which led to other modeling jobs, and appearances in various music videos. After stumbling across budding director, Harmony Korine, in Washington Square Park, she made her debut in his film, “Kids”.

Early Life and Education Dan Soder was born on June 24, 1983 in Hartford, Connecticut and was raised in Aurora, Colorado. He is of Irish ancestry. When Soder was a teenager, he lost his father to an illness and his sister in a car accident. For his higher education, he went to the University of Arizona, where he began performing as a stand-up comic. Soder graduated in 2005 with degrees in political science and journalism.

David Cassidy was born April 12, 1950 in New York City, New York. He was the son of actor and singer Jack Cassidy. Growing up, he was surrounded by show business as Cassidy’s mother, Evelyn Ward, was also an actress. His parents divorced when he was a child and his father married actress and singer Shirley Jones in 1956, making her David’s stepmother. In a twist of irony, Jones and Cassidy went on to play mother and son on “The Partridge Family”, which debuted in the fall of 1970.

Flea purchased the compound, located in the La Crescenta neighborhood outside LA proper, in 2018 for $4.5 million, but that price doesn’t include the 875-foot addition the property’s listing says was completed by Maltzan in 2021. As for that original 1954 home, it was the work of architect Richard Neutra for his secretary at the time, Dorothy Serulnic, and her husband George. Here’s how the Dorothy Serulnic Residence, now a guest house on the compound, is described in the listing: “The 1,350 sq ft floor plan features 2 bedrooms, one bath, walls of glass, a bear valley stone fireplace and a plethora of Neutra designed built-ins, including a sofa system with record player and concealed speakers, multiple desks, shelving systems, dining room table, sliding breakfast nook and vanity.

Tom and Judy Love married in 1961. Three years later they took their entire life savings, roughly $5000, and leased an abandoned gas station in Watonga, Oklahoma – a town an hour northwest of Oklahoma City. In case you were wondering, $5000 in 1964 is worth the equivalent to $38,000 today. Tom and Judy named their fledgling company the Musket Corporation. Over the next eight years, Musket opened 40 additional gas stations around Oklahoma.

Weird Al Yankovic, also known as Alfred Matthew Yankovic, was born in Downey, California on October 23, 1959. His father always said to make a living doing whatever made him happy, so when he discovered a love of music when he was in elementary school, “Weird Al” knew what he wanted to do. He began playing accordion when he was six, and took lessons at school for three years. He was very smart for his age and started kindergarten when he was four, instead of five.

Early Life Hugh Anthony Cregg III, better known by his professional name Huey Lewis, was born in New York City on July 5, 1950. His father, Hugh Anthony Cregg Jr., was from Boston, and is from an Irish-American family. His mother, Maria Magdalena Barcinski, was from Warsaw, Poland. Although he was born in New York City, Lewis was actually raised in California. There, he and his family lived in various places around Marin County, including Tamalpais Valley, Strawberry, and Mill Valley.

Early Life Jillian Reynolds was born Jillian Marie Warry on September 26, 1966, in Burlington, Ontario, Canada. She was adopted as an infant and was a victim of sexual abuse during her youth. With the help of a private detective, Reynolds found her biological parents as an adult and learned that she has two sisters. She told “People” magazine in 2009 that she’s close to both her biological and adoptive families, adding, “When I spoke with my birth father for the first time, he told me I had sisters – not just half-sisters, but full sisters, since he and my mom had ended up marrying and raising a family.

Early Life and Education John Heard was born on March 7, 1946 in Washington, DC to John Sr. and Helen. His father worked for the office of the Secretary of Defense, while his mother appeared in community theater. As a teenager, Heard went to Gonzaga College High School. He subsequently attended Clark University in Worcester, Massachusetts, and then the Catholic University of America back in Washington, DC. Heard has two sisters, and had a brother who passed away in 2017.

Early Life José Andrés was born as José Ramón Andrés Puerta on July 13, 1969 in Mieres, Asturias, Spain. When he was six, he moved with his family to Catalonia. There, in Barcelona, he enrolled in culinary school at the age of 15. When he was required to serve in the Spanish military at age 18, Andrés did so as a cook for an admiral. He subsequently met chef Ferran Adrià, for whom he worked at the restaurant El Bulli from 1988 to 1990.
